Kalenice
Kalenice is a municipality and village in Strakonice District in the South Bohemian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 80 inhabitants.

Kalenice lies approximately 14 kilometres (9 mi) west of Strakonice, 65 km (40 mi) north-west of České Budějovice, and 104 km (65 mi) south-west of Prague.
